Tijuana Indie Film Wins Best Feature Film at the Houston Latino Film Festival

A 100% Tijuana-made film

Amir, an indie movie that was filmed in Tijuana, won Best Feature Film at the Houston Latino Film Festival, which took place on March 25th to the 27th.

Directed by José Paredes and with performances by actors Jorge Guevara, Tania Niebla, Lirio Karina, Paul Jiménez, Fernando Fisher and Pedro Rodman.

It tells the story of a young retired musician who reaches a quandary of staying with his girlfriend during an unplanned pregnancy or choose a girl who he just met, a beautiful singer who has a local band and is the source of a renewed passion for the music and overall, love.

Amir also won the "Best Border Film" Award at the San Diego Latino Film Festival 2016
